Samantha Burnell

Samantha Burnell is the author of the Richard Fitzwarren Tudor Historical series which currently consists of 11 novels. The Richard Fitzwarren Tudor Historical series started in 2018 with the novel The Tudor Heresy. The most recently released novel in the Richard Fitzwarren Tudor Historical series was A Queen's Privateer which was released in 2025. There are no upcoming novels for the Richard Fitzwarren Tudor Historical series.

Samantha Burnell has also written the Myles Devereux Murder Mystery series which has 3 books including An Invisible Betrayal and Chance is a Game.
